Enabling a Zero-Downtime Database Migration for a Major Retail Group
Modernizing Cloud Database Infrastructure
For one of South America’s largest multi-format retail groups, operating across grocery, department stores, home improvement, and financial services, database performance and reliability are central to keeping customer-facing systems and internal operations running smoothly.
To modernize its cloud database infrastructure, the retailer engaged Delbridge to migrate a critical workload from Azure CosmosDB (Mongo API) to MongoDB Atlas. The objective was a clean, fully validated migration across both Dev and Production environments, executed without operational disruption and with a clear handover that allowed the client’s internal team to control the final cutover on their own timeline.
The Delbridge Approach
Delbridge delivered the migration as a structured, end-to-end engagement spanning roughly 20 working days. The scope covered approximately 27 GB of data across 8 collections, with the source schema preserved as-is so that application and microservice changes could remain entirely on the client’s side. The final cutover was likewise kept under client control, with Delbridge providing the tooling, validation, and documentation needed to execute it safely.
Rather than treating the migration as a single high-risk event, Delbridge structured the work around repeatable dry runs, automated validation, and continuous data replication. This approach allowed the client’s team to gain confidence in the process before committing to production, and to schedule the cutover at a time that suited their business operations.
Hands-On, End-to-End
Long-Term Resilience
The Challenge: Migrating a Production Workload Without Disruption
Moving a live workload between two different cloud database platforms required careful planning around data integrity, replication continuity, and operational risk. The client was not looking for a basic lift-and-shift, but for a migration that could be validated rigorously and handed over in a way that preserved their control over the final cutover.
A cross-platform migration with no room for data loss
A need for both bulk migration and ongoing replication
Field-level validation requirements
Multi-environment coordination
A client-controlled cutover boundary
Performance parity expectations
Delivery and Execution

A key part of the work involved provisioning and configuring the new MongoDB Atlas clusters for both Dev and Production, and standing up DSync as the data movement layer covering both the initial bulk migration and ongoing change data capture. Using a single tool across both phases reduced operational complexity and gave the client a consistent replication path through to cutover.
Delbridge also built a custom document-comparison validation harness in Node.js, packaged to run in Docker and driven by configuration files specifying collections and document IDs. This harness was used after every migration pass to confirm field-level parity between CosmosDB and Atlas, giving the client objective evidence of data integrity rather than relying on row counts or sampling.


Three full dry runs were executed across Dev and Production before the production migration itself, with the validation harness run at each stage. Both environments were performance-tested against the CosmosDB baseline, and post-migration monitoring was configured on Atlas to support ongoing visibility.
Taken together, these activities allowed the production migration to be executed cleanly, with live CDC keeping the source and target in sync. The client’s internal team retained full control over the final cutover, supported by a zero-downtime playbook that removed the need for any data-freeze window.
Results
The engagement gave the retailer a fully validated migration path from Azure CosmosDB to MongoDB Atlas, executed end-to-end in roughly 20 working days. By combining a single replication layer for bulk and CDC, a custom validation harness, and multiple dry runs, Delbridge helped create a migration process that was both rigorous and repeatable.
Just as importantly, the engagement was structured to respect the client’s operational boundaries. Application changes and the final cutover stayed on the internal team’s side, supported by a clear handover playbook that allowed them to execute the switch at their own pace without a data-freeze window.
For a retail group of this scale, this kind of migration extends beyond moving data between platforms. It helps reduce delivery risk, preserve operational control, and give internal teams the confidence to take ownership of the new environment from day one.
- Migration of ~27 GB across 8 collections completed with no incidents
- 100% data integrity confirmed via a custom field-level validation harness
- Three successful dry runs executed before the production migration
- Live CDC maintained between CosmosDB and Atlas through the cutover window
- Atlas performance met or exceeded the CosmosDB baseline
- Post-migration monitoring configured on Atlas
- Zero-downtime cutover playbook delivered to the internal dev team

Whether you are modernizing legacy systems, migrating large and complex datasets, transforming data for MongoDB, or replacing outdated migration methods, Delbridge delivers a structured, scalable migration framework built to move your organization forward with speed, control, and confidence.
What do we deliver ?
“Always-on” Monitoring
1Timely Incident Response
2Cluster Provisioning
3Backup and Recovery Management
4Upgrades and Change Management
5Risk Mitigation
6
Project Details


Project Stats
27 GB
8
3
20 Working Days
100%
Zero
Live CDC

Our MongoDB Expertise
14+
100+
45+
Fast Start
Migration foundation deployed with documented patterns and standards.Environment-ready and built to scale.
Best Suited For:
- Small budgets
- Fast turnarounds that demonstrate value
- Proving capability
- Building momentum